Searched refs:virt_addr (Results 1 - 25 of 40) sorted by relevance

12

/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/include/asm-i386/
H A Dedac.h8 unsigned long *virt_addr = va; local
11 for (i = 0; i < size / 4; i++, virt_addr++)
15 __asm__ __volatile__("lock; addl $0, %0"::"m"(*virt_addr));
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/include/asm-x86_64/
H A Dedac.h8 unsigned int *virt_addr = va; local
11 for (i = 0; i < size / 4; i++, virt_addr++)
15 __asm__ __volatile__("lock; addl $0, %0"::"m"(*virt_addr));
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/include/asm-powerpc/
H A Dedac.h21 unsigned int *virt_addr = va; local
25 for (i = 0; i < size / sizeof(*virt_addr); i++, virt_addr++) {
35 : "r"(virt_addr)
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/arch/sparc/mm/
H A Dnosrmmu.c43 void srmmu_mapioaddr(unsigned long physaddr, unsigned long virt_addr, int bus_type, int rdonly) argument
47 void srmmu_unmapioaddr(unsigned long virt_addr) argument
H A Dnosun4c.c43 void sun4c_mapioaddr(unsigned long physaddr, unsigned long virt_addr, int bus_type, int rdonly) argument
47 void sun4c_unmapioaddr(unsigned long virt_addr) argument
H A Dsrmmu.c569 unsigned long virt_addr, int bus_type)
577 pgdp = pgd_offset_k(virt_addr);
578 pmdp = srmmu_pmd_offset(pgdp, virt_addr);
579 ptep = srmmu_pte_offset(pmdp, virt_addr);
589 __flush_page_to_ram(virt_addr);
605 static inline void srmmu_unmapioaddr(unsigned long virt_addr) argument
611 pgdp = pgd_offset_k(virt_addr);
612 pmdp = srmmu_pmd_offset(pgdp, virt_addr);
613 ptep = srmmu_pte_offset(pmdp, virt_addr);
619 static void srmmu_unmapiorange(unsigned long virt_addr, unsigne argument
568 srmmu_mapioaddr(unsigned long physaddr, unsigned long virt_addr, int bus_type) argument
[all...]
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/w1/masters/
H A Dmatrox_w1.c87 void __iomem *virt_addr; member in struct:matrox_device
186 dev->virt_addr = ioremap_nocache(dev->phys_addr, 16384);
187 if (!dev->virt_addr) {
194 dev->base_addr = dev->virt_addr + MATROX_BASE;
218 if (dev->virt_addr)
219 iounmap(dev->virt_addr);
233 iounmap(dev->virt_addr);
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/include/asm-sparc/
H A Doplib.h66 extern void prom_unmapio(char *virt_addr, unsigned int num_bytes);
206 extern void prom_free(char *virt_addr, unsigned int size);
213 extern void prom_putsegment(int context, unsigned long virt_addr,
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/include/asm-m68k/
H A Doplib.h60 extern void prom_unmapio(char *virt_addr, unsigned int num_bytes);
195 extern void prom_free(char *virt_addr, unsigned int size);
202 extern void prom_putsegment(int context, unsigned long virt_addr,
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/arch/i386/mm/
H A Dioremap.c257 unsigned long virt_addr; local
262 virt_addr = (unsigned long)addr;
263 if (virt_addr < fix_to_virt(FIX_BTMAP_BEGIN))
265 offset = virt_addr & ~PAGE_MASK;
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/arch/powerpc/platforms/ps3/
H A Dmm.c103 * virt_addr: a cpu 'translated' effective address
554 * @virt_addr: Starting virtual address of the area to map.
562 static int dma_map_area(struct ps3_dma_region *r, unsigned long virt_addr, argument
568 unsigned long phys_addr = is_kernel_addr(virt_addr) ? __pa(virt_addr)
569 : virt_addr;
576 DBG("%s:%d virt_addr %lxh\n", __func__, __LINE__,
577 virt_addr);
723 * @virt_addr: Starting virtual address of the area to map.
733 unsigned long virt_addr, unsigne
732 dma_map_area_linear(struct ps3_dma_region *r, unsigned long virt_addr, unsigned long len, unsigned long *bus_addr) argument
770 ps3_dma_map(struct ps3_dma_region *r, unsigned long virt_addr, unsigned long len, unsigned long *bus_addr) argument
[all...]
H A Dsystem-bus.c194 unsigned long virt_addr; local
201 virt_addr = __get_free_pages(flag, get_order(size));
203 if (!virt_addr) {
208 result = ps3_dma_map(dev->d_region, virt_addr, size, dma_handle);
217 return (void*)virt_addr;
220 free_pages(virt_addr, get_order(size));
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/acpi/
H A Dosl.c440 void __iomem *virt_addr; local
442 virt_addr = ioremap(phys_addr, width);
448 *(u8 *) value = readb(virt_addr);
451 *(u16 *) value = readw(virt_addr);
454 *(u32 *) value = readl(virt_addr);
460 iounmap(virt_addr);
468 void __iomem *virt_addr; local
470 virt_addr = ioremap(phys_addr, width);
474 writeb(value, virt_addr);
477 writew(value, virt_addr);
[all...]
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/arch/ia64/kernel/
H A Derr_inject.c137 u64 virt_addr=simple_strtoull(buf, NULL, 16); local
140 ret = get_user_pages(current, current->mm, virt_addr,
144 printk("Virtual address %lx is not existing.\n",virt_addr);
149 phys_addr[cpu] = ia64_tpa(virt_addr);
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/arch/mips/pci/
H A Dops-ddb5477.c70 u32 virt_addr; local
106 virt_addr = KSEG1ADDR(swap->config_base + pci_addr);
110 virt_addr = KSEG1ADDR(swap->config_base);
120 return virt_addr;
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/mtd/
H A Dftl.c836 u_int32_t virt_addr)
847 part, log_addr, virt_addr);
863 if (((virt_addr == 0xfffffffe) && !BLOCK_FREE(old_addr)) ||
864 ((virt_addr == 0) && (BLOCK_TYPE(old_addr) != BLOCK_DATA)) ||
865 (!BLOCK_DELETED(virt_addr) && (old_addr != 0xfffffffe))) {
870 ", new = 0x%x\n", log_addr, old_addr, virt_addr);
875 le_virt_addr = cpu_to_le32(virt_addr);
898 log_addr, virt_addr);
906 u_int32_t bsize, log_addr, virt_addr, old_addr, blk; local
926 virt_addr
835 set_bam_entry(partition_t *part, u_int32_t log_addr, u_int32_t virt_addr) argument
[all...]
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/infiniband/hw/mlx4/
H A Dmr.c123 u64 virt_addr, int access_flags,
145 err = mlx4_mr_alloc(dev->dev, to_mpd(pd)->pdn, virt_addr, length,
122 mlx4_ib_reg_user_mr(struct ib_pd *pd, u64 start, u64 length, u64 virt_addr, int access_flags, struct ib_udata *udata) argument
H A Dmlx4_ib.h236 u64 virt_addr, int access_flags,
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/arch/powerpc/mm/
H A Dpgtable_64.c317 void __iomem *virt_addr; local
323 virt_addr = (void __iomem *) phbs_io_bot;
327 return virt_addr;
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/video/pnx4008/
H A Dsdum.h138 int pnx4008_get_fb_addresses(int fb_type, void **virt_addr,
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/infiniband/hw/ehca/
H A Dehca_uverbs.c145 u64 virt_addr = (u64)ipz_qeit_calc(queue, ofs); local
146 page = virt_to_page(virt_addr);
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/infiniband/ulp/iser/
H A Diser_initiator.c222 regd_hdr->virt_addr = rx_desc; /* == &rx_desc->iser_header */
232 regd_data->virt_addr = rx_desc->data;
260 regd_hdr->virt_addr = tx_desc; /* == &tx_desc->iser_header */
515 regd_buf->virt_addr = mtask->data;
563 rx_data = dto->regd[1]->virt_addr;
H A Discsi_iser.h183 void *virt_addr; member in struct:iser_regd_buf
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/arch/i386/kernel/
H A Defi.c467 addr = md->virt_addr - md->phys_addr +
560 md->virt_addr = (unsigned long)ioremap(md->phys_addr,
562 if (!(unsigned long)md->virt_addr) {
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/infiniband/hw/ipath/
H A Dipath_mr.c177 * @virt_addr: virtual address to use (from HCA's point of view)
184 u64 virt_addr, int mr_access_flags,
215 mr->mr.iova = virt_addr;
183 ipath_reg_user_mr(struct ib_pd *pd, u64 start, u64 length, u64 virt_addr, int mr_access_flags, struct ib_udata *udata) argument

Completed in 138 milliseconds

12